Stunning Deluxe Four CD Box Chronicling Ralph's 40 Year Career to Date, Starting with Early Private Recordings in 1965 to Songs Recorded for this Project in the Summer of 2006. 30 Tracks Are Previously Unreleased - Including Rare Outtakes, Live Performances, and Demo Recordings. Includes Full Color Booklet and Many Tracks have Guest Performances from John Renbourne, Dave Swarbrick, Richard Thompson, Danny Thompson, Bruce Barthol (Country Joe and Fish), James Burton (Elvis Presley), Rod Clements (Lindisfarne) and Many More.

"It's about time a retrospective set was done on this fine English singer-songwriter's long career. Always pretty much unknown in the United States but a national treasure in Britian, Mc Tell deserves a set like this and more, please! With four discs issued by his own recording company this set hits most of the highlights of his 40 year career but, of course long time fans will start counting the ones they missed and should haves but, that would have run to at least six discs! Good selection of rarities, nice booklet makes this worth the price. Shame he never made it in the US, maybe we don't deserve someone this good, just James Taylor and Jackson Browne. McTell WIPES THE FLOOR with both of them and is one hell of a great guitarist and singer to boot! This box set will be wonderful for long time fans, maybe a little too much for new ones. If you're new to him find any of his Lps/Cds and give him a try, he's original and addictive!! Good job on this Ralph!"
